Syncing Sony and the iPhone
Reason I ask is that, when I bought my iPhone, I was so eager to test out the eReader App that I bought a Stuart Woods book ('Dirt') forgetting that I already had it on my Sony 505. Anyway, I just got around to reading it on my 505 and have found it very useful to be able to switch between the Sony and the iPhone. I almost always have one or the other with me. Is there a way to legally do this?

The legality is a bit nebulous and depends on the country you are in. But, you can remove the DRM from an eReader ebook and then convert it to LRF for the sony. Calibre converts the HTML result file from the ereader2html script.

Another option is to buy LIT/Mobi ebooks as you would normally for the Sony and then convert them to ePub with calibre and use Stanza on the iPhone to read them.
Either way you do you have to break the DRM. BOb
